Our facility and operations
We are proud to run a financially stable association that is largely financed by our approximately 460 members. At present, we have 170 children/young people in training and about 70 adults. Every year we have summer camps, competitions and activities for both juniors and seniors.

About Sandared
Sandared is located just outside Borås next to Lake Viaredssjön and has just over 3000 inhabitants. The town is one of Borås’ four service towns and has a secondary school, library, medical centre and sports and swimming hall. The tennis club’s facility is located right by the lake and has three indoor courts, three outdoor courts and a padel court.
Sandared has a rich association life and, in addition to the tennis club, there are associations for football, floorball, sailing, table tennis and swimming.
